WebOct 18, 2024 · The exact steps in an SSL handshake vary depending on the version of SSL the client and server decide to use, but the general process is outlined below. The client says hello. This “client hello” message lists cryptographic information, including the SSL version to use to communicate with each other. The four way handshake is actually very simple, but clever: The AP sends a value to the Client. (This is not protected in any way). The client generates a key and sends back its own random value and as code to verify that value using the value that the AP sent.
